We don't know that's how the binder works. It's most likely it doesn't work like that. There's a binder for channelers and a binder for non-channelers and personally I think it has to do with physical differences, namely that channelers have different brains, or at least, their minds become altered when they're teenagers and exposed to the Source for the first time.


Either the Binder works on the soul or the connection to the Power. Either way, the most important thing is the outcome - the skin is tightened and an effect very similar to (a literally skin deep) powerful Compulsion is laid on the channeler. As I noted, being a channeler and holding the Power already protects you from certain things, such as Compulsion, aging and illnesses, while a non-channeler is afflicted with these ailments. Even if we don't know how or why this is the case, all we need to know is that the Binder requires some element present in channelers but not non-channelers to work. You can swap in connection to the Source, channeling soul or brain difference as needed, but the inherent logic remains the same.

If the Binder did work on the soul, perhaps Mesaana is protected because hers is given to the Dark One or perhaps she made a mindtrap for herself to house her soul temporarily.

You don't even need to hold the Source to be bound... someone else can channel Spirit into the rod, so long as you touch it. A link would be just as useless, and even worse, the Sisters around would definitely notice. Mesaana would never trust her fate to the treacherous Black Ajah anyway... Liandrin was a murderous sneak at the best of times around Moghedien.


But we already know that there are many channeling abilities that don't require holding the Source, one of which is the manipulation of your link/connection to the Power to escape a Shield. Note I never said Mesaana had to hold the Power while swearing - all I said was that she used the increased capacity of a Link to Shield herself from the full effects of the Binder. She could actually invert her weaves hiding her ability to channel and her hold on the Source appearing as if she didn't touch the Power with noone being the wiser - Egwene knows about inverting weaves and hiding your channeling, but not how to detect if someone else is doing the same.

Mesaana wouldn't need to trust her fate to the Black Ajah - if she was the leader, she would actually have them at her mercy, since it would be up to her when to dissolve the Link. And this fits in with the possible need to defend herself if her subterfuge was discovered - with access to such a Link, she could overwhelm many Sisters during her escape attempt if her plan went awry.
